Least Common Multiple of 80159 and 80177 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 80159 and 80177, than apply into the LCM equation.

GCF(80159,80177) = 1
LCM(80159,80177) = ( 80159 × 80177) / 1
LCM(80159,80177) = 6426908143 / 1
LCM(80159,80177) = 6426908143
